The LG G7 Fit is slightly better than the Nokia 9 PureView, having a 77 score against 76.4. The LG G7 Fit body has the same thickness than Nokia 9 PureView, but it's a bit lighter. The LG G7 Fit has a sharper display than Nokia 9 PureView, because it has a slightly better resolution of 1440 x 3120, a bit larger screen and a bit better quantity of pixels per inch in the screen.
Nokia 9 PureView features a little bit better performance than LG G7 Fit, because it has a higher amount of RAM memory and a larger number of cores. The LG G7 Fit has a superior storage to store more apps and games than Nokia 9 PureView, because although it has 0 less internal memory capacity, it also counts with a SD memory slot that admits up to 1,95 TB.
The Nokia 9 PureView counts with just a little bit longer battery duration than LG G7 Fit, because it has a 3320mAh battery capacity. The LG G7 Fit features a little bit better camera than Nokia 9 PureView, because although it has a tinier diafragm aperture which is worse for low-light photography and video and a smaller sensor capturing worse quality images, and they both have the same 30 frames per second video frame rate and the same 3840x2160 video resolution, the LG G7 Fit also counts with a back-facing camera with a way better 16 mega-pixels resolution.
